Font Size: a A A

Research On Pushing Protocol For Content In Mobile Social Opportunity Network

Posted on:2014-02-02Degree:MasterType:Thesis
Country:ChinaCandidate:Y Y PeiFull Text:PDF
GTID:2268330401477741Subject:Computer Science and Technology
Abstract/Summary:PDF Full Text Request
With the development of mobile intellect equipment, it is more popular that the opportunity network application which communicates through the mobile equipment carried by human. As there exists a society relationship between human beings, opportunity network is becoming mobile social opportunistic network gradually. In this network, people use various of kinds of mobile equipment to send and share the message with adjacent users or the people who exist in society relationship. Same as opportunity network, in mobile opportunistic network, the transfer of users realized the communication between users. And the society relationship between users drives the transfer of users. In communication, it not only has relationship with network topology, but also with the sending message. So mobile social opportunistic networks need the routing combines the content with the context. This paper aims to research the content pushing, with analyzing the context of users and the content of message.This paper first summarize the mobile social opportunistic networks, including the concept of mobile social opportunistic networks, research background, the research actuality at home and abroad, the main application and the critical issues and so on. Also we research and analyze the current content pushing mechanism of mobile social opportunistic networks and the routing algorithms. Current content pushing mechanism is divided into2kinds. One is central pushing. There is a third party, it is similar with server. Based on the theme record left by user at third party, it sends corresponding pushing message to users. Another kind is distributed pushing. User chooses appropriate message to push, with calculating the utility value created by the message to the user met with. Current routing algorithm optimizes the message transferring, mainly through analyzing the connection of nodes. However, it did not consider the relevance between message and nodes, maybe it will cause the issue of node receiving the no need or uninterested message and so on, wasting the precious network source.To aim at the shortcomings of the existing routing algorithms, this paper presented a dynamic routing protocol based on MPR and evaluating function (ORPME). Firstly, the MPR set is ensured and the nodes in the MPR set are ranked on the basis of the evaluation function. In wireless communications, data packets will be forwarded to nodes with high success rate of transferring according to the local-storage MPR set, if none of those nodes can be found in the MPR set, they will be the randomly selected outside of the MPR set, directional and random forwarding supplement to each other to make the data packets be accurately forwarded to destination node in a shorter time.To deal with the issues on the pushing algorithms at above, this paper considers abundantly the communication times between nodes, communication times, the similarity of theme collection, the relevance between message and context of nodes, proposes a Role-and Context-based content pushing. This mechanism builds the role aim function. With analyzing the communication times between nodes, communication time, the similarity of theme collection, divides the role for nodes, and designs corresponding pushing mechanism for different roles. Based on the role message of the node met with, it chooses the corresponding pushing mechanism, to realize pushing.Finally, we use the real dataset to make sure the range of the Role function. And we use NS-2network simulating tools to simulate the algorithm this paper proposed. Then, it compared the RCCP algorithm with ORPME and PrefCast algorithms, and analyses the experiment results.
Keywords/Search Tags:mobile social opportunistic network, context, node roles, contentpushing
PDF Full Text Request
Related items